Full Time Adas Calibration specialists focus on performing precise sensor calibrations, often requiring advanced certifications and working mainly in calibration labs. Adas Technicians handle diagnostics and repairs of ADAS systems, with a broader scope of automotive repair skills. Both roles are essential in the automotive industry but differ in focus and work environment.
